6.2 TRABALHOS FUTUROS
De forma a dar prosseguimento ao trabalho, algumas propostas para trabalhos futuros são:
1. Estudo de otimização dos ângulos de início e término da excitação;
2. Controle de potência utilizando técnica de modos deslizantes;
3. Conexão do gerador à rede elétrica;
4. Desenvolvimento de técnicas de controle em tempo discreto;

Apêndice A – BANCADA EXPERIMENTAL
Uma bancada de testes foi projetada e desenvolvida para a obtenção de resultados experimentais que permitam a validação das técnicas apresentadas, além de futuros es- tudos envolvendo máquinas de relutância variável. A Figura A.1 apresenta um diagrama de blocos com uma visão geral do sistema implementado.

o C R Tem q Fonte: Autor.A bancada é composta por uma máquina de indução (fonte primária), pelo gerador de relutância variável, gabinete de comando do gerador, inversor para acionamento da MI e carga. Um sensor de posição (encoder ) é acoplado ao eixo da máquina de indução. Um transdutor de torque (torquímetro) é incluído no acoplamento entre a máquina primária e o gerador. Na Figura A.2 são apresentadas as máquinas utilizadas e a estrutura construída para acoplá-las. A Figura A.3 apresenta uma foto da bancada completa. Os sistemas que a compõe são detalhados nas seções a seguir.
